What You’ll Do

  • Contribute to the development of data analytics infrastructure that supports safety assurance analytics addressing internal and external stakeholder needs across the phases of automated vehicle development and deployment, including both real-world and simulation data.
  • Apply your AI/ML expertise to developing trustworthy and explainable methods for validating the safety performance of an AI/ML based automated driving system.
  • Mentor and develop team members in the appropriate implementation of AI/ML to support the mission of the SAFE-ADS department and AV Safety Engineering Analytics team.
  • Pilot and develop metrics for monitoring of development operations and deployment, and establish sufficiency criteria for launch readiness.
  • Develop methods for leveraging a variety of internal and external data sources for AI/ML based safety monitoring and contribute to the development of a reliable supply chain of continuously flowing data from a variety of sources (internal and external) to support safety assurance related activities.
  • Implement cloud-based continuous up-time analytics solutions for monitoring driving performance for safety and generating browser based interactive visualizations and periodic reporting artifacts.
  • Actively contribute to determining appropriate use of AI/ML approaches within automated driving systems and provide technical expertise to inform leadership decision-making regarding mechanisms for ensuring they are trustworthy and explainable.
  • Through AI/ML expertise, contribute to the definition of GM’s data sourcing and processing strategy for AV safety assurance needs, engage externally to influence evolving standards, and contribute to internal and external thought leadership that strengthens GM’s position in the autonomous vehicle ecosystem.
  • Represent SAFE-ADS in AI/ML related discussions across Global Product Safety, Systems, and Certification activities.
  • Identify and drive opportunities to improve the efficiency, quality and transparency of safety analytics within GPSSC and across GM.
